Mama Roselie Ko’ngo now 89 years old, raising her two  grandchildren (Nancy and Vionah) is one of our fast beneficiaries to receive a donation of four grown goats from #AFCAids. During there times she got married to “Reach family” not in terms of big cars,good house,lots of money but  by the number cattle she had, she had lots of cows and goats which used to give her milk that she needed to maintain her big family of, her home was nicknamed “ land of Canaan” because of the large quantity of milk she used to produce.

After few years in her marriage, bad spirit of death visited her home “Bad Omen”, she started by losing her husband, then her children. She could not imagine being a life to bury her children and her husband.

She buried all her 8 sons that God gave her, as if that is not enough the Bad Omen again started with her daughters, God gave her life again to bury her daughters and her granddaughters, she was forced to sell out her cows and goats one by one as some were also dying due to drought.

Through our  livelihood project aiming to eradicate poverty, she is now happy to drink good milk with her grandchildren- milk that she used to drink 30 years ago, she is now able to have access to, just two days ago a female goat delivered a baby male goat,

s2670047Kong’o is born

mama says she wants to name it after her husband, Kong’o. And here comes dignity , since she will  give back four fully grown goats to another another orphan family which is struggling (three more to come), here #AFCAid nor #RHM will not give , but mama Roselie will give. “how do you feel if you are the one giving back to another needy person like you”, I ask her, and this is what she had to say “Since I was given four goats so that I can get help, I will be happy to also help a struggling grandmother just like me”,.
